SAN FRANCISCO, Dec 9 (Reuters) – Nvidia (NVDA.O), opens new tab has built location verification technology that could indicate which country its chips are operating in, according to sources familiar with the matter, a move that could help prevent its artificial intelligence chips from being smuggled into countries where their export is banned.

The feature, which Nvidia has demonstrated privately in recent months but has not yet released, would be a software option that customers could install. It would tap into what are known as the confidential computing capabilities of its graphics processing units (GPUs), the sources said.

The software was built to allow customers to track a chip’s overall computing performance – a common practice among companies that buy fleets of processors for large data centers – and would use the time delay in communicating with servers run by Nvidia to give a sense of the chip’s location on par with what other internet-based services can provide, according to an Nvidia official.
